An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Supported Housing Officer at a National Charity, providing comprehensive housing management and estate services for supported housing residents. This home-based role offers an opportunity for those experienced in housing management to make a real impact within the community.

THE ROLE
Responsibilities

As a Supported Housing Officer, you will play a key role in managing housing services within your designated patch. You will be responsible for providing housing management and supporting vulnerable residents. Key responsibilities include:

  1. Leading housing management activities within your patch, supporting vulnerable residents.
  2. Managing income recovery and ensuring tenants meet payment obligations.
  3. Handling neighbour nuisance/conflict issues and managing estate management.
  4. Working closely with area teams to ensure comprehensive service delivery.
  5. Liaising with residents to ensure tenancy/licence agreements are understood and adhered to.
  6. Providing housing advice, support, and resolving issues promptly.
  7. Ensuring all records are maintained and updated according to contractual requirements.
THE CANDIDATE

To be considered for this role, candidates must meet the following key requirements:

  1. 1+ years of experience in legal action/housing officer role.
  2. 6+ months of experience in income collection.
  3. Familiarity with tenancy/licence agreements.
  4. Remote, but needs to be based in North West, West Midlands, or Leeds/Yorkshire Area.
Additional Experience Required Includes
  1. Experience in supported housing or similar housing management roles.
  2. Strong understanding of housing laws and regulations.
  3. Ability to handle neighbour disputes, nuisance, and conflict management.
  4. Excellent communication skills and a proactive problem-solving attitude.
  5. Ability to work collaboratively within area teams to deliver the best outcomes for residents.
THE CONTRACT
  1. 35 hours per week, Monday to Friday, 9 AM - 5 PM
  2. Remote
  3. 3-month contract, with the potential to become permanent
  4. £17.07 per hour LTD / £14.55 per hour PAYE (inclusive of holiday pay).
